Best Areas for Sea Kayaking in Corfu

Paleokastritsa – Cliffs, Caves and Turquoise Water

One of the most famous kayaking areas on the island is Paleokastritsa. Surrounded by dramatic limestone cliffs and emerald bays, this region offers some of the most beautiful paddling routes in Greece.

From the beach, you can paddle along towering cliffs and explore hidden sea caves carved by the waves over centuries.

Some of the highlights include:

  • hidden turquoise coves
  • dramatic cliff formations
  • small caves accessible only by kayak
  • crystal-clear snorkeling spots

Many paddlers consider Paleokastritsa the best kayaking location on Corfu.

Porto Timoni – A Double Beach Paradise

One of the most unique places you can reach by kayak is Porto Timoni Beach.

This spectacular location features two beaches separated by a narrow strip of land, creating one of the most photogenic spots on the island.

Kayaking here allows you to avoid the steep hiking trail and arrive directly from the sea.

The water here is incredibly clear, making it perfect for swimming and snorkeling breaks during your paddle.

---

Rovinia Beach – A Hidden Gem

Another beautiful destination for kayaking is Rovinia Beach.

This secluded beach is surrounded by white cliffs and dense green vegetation. Because access by land requires a long walk, kayaking is one of the best ways to reach it.

Expect:

  • bright turquoise water
  • quiet natural surroundings
  • excellent swimming conditions

It is one of the most peaceful stops during a kayaking tour.

Explore Corfu’s Sea Caves

One of the biggest highlights of kayaking in Corfu is exploring its spectacular sea caves.

Some caves are large enough to paddle directly inside with your kayak, where sunlight reflecting from the water creates incredible shades of blue and emerald.

These caves are most commonly found along the rocky coastline near Paleokastritsa.

Inside the caves you will often find calm water and fascinating rock formations created by centuries of wave erosion.

Where to Stay in Corfu for Kayaking

If kayaking is your main activity, staying near the west coast is the best choice.

The most convenient areas include:

  • Paleokastritsa – perfect for caves and cliffs
  • Agios Gordios – beautiful beach and kayaking routes
  • Arillas – quieter atmosphere and easy paddling

These locations offer quick access to some of the island’s best kayaking routes.

Best Time for Sea Kayaking in Corfu

The kayaking season usually runs from May to October.

The best months are:

  • May–June – calm seas and fewer tourists
  • September–October – warm water and quieter beaches

Early morning paddling offers the calmest conditions and the most beautiful light for photography.
